JavaScript原生对象API实现流程
1. 确定需求和目标
在开始实现JavaScript原生对象API之前,我们需要明确具体的需求和目标。原生对象API是指JavaScript语言内置的对象提供的方法和属性,这些方法和属性可以帮助我们完成各种操作和功能。我们的目标是能够熟练使用和理解JavaScript原生对象API。
2. 学习JavaScript的基础知识
在开始使用JavaScript原生对象API之前,我们需要对JavaScript的基础知识进行学习和掌握。这包括语法、数据类型、变量、函数、循环等基本概念和操作。只有理解了这些基础知识,才能更好地理解和应用JavaScript原生对象API。
3. 学习和了解JavaScript原生对象API
JavaScript原生对象API分为不同的对象,每个对象都提供了一系列的方法和属性。我们需要学习和了解这些对象的用途和功能,并且熟悉它们的使用方法。以下是一些常用的JavaScript原生对象API及其用途:
对象 | 用途 |
---|---|
Array | 处理数组的方法和属性 |
String | 处理字符串的方法和属性 |
Math | 提供数学计算相关的方法和属性 |
Date | 处理日期和时间的方法和属性 |
Object | 处理对象的方法和属性 |
JSON | 解析和序列化JSON数据的方法 |
4. 具体实现步骤和代码示例
接下来我们将逐步实现JavaScript原生对象API的使用。以下是具体的实现步骤和代码示例:
步骤一:使用Array对象的方法和属性
- 创建一个空数组:
let array = [];
- 向数组中添加元素:
array.push(1); // 在数组末尾添加元素1
array.push(2); // 在数组末尾添加元素2
- 获取数组的长度:
let length = array.length;
- 遍历数组并输出每个元素:
for (let i = 0; i < array.length; i++) {
console.log(array[i]);
}
步骤二:使用String对象的方法和属性
- 创建一个字符串:
let str = "Hello, World!";
- 获取字符串的长度:
let length = str.length;
- 查找字符串中的子串:
let index = str.indexOf("World"); // 返回子串的起始位置
- 截取字符串的一部分:
let substring = str.substring(0, 5); // 返回从起始位置到结束位置的子串
步骤三:使用Math对象的方法和属性
- 获取随机数:
let random = Math.random(); // 返回0到1之间的随机数
- 对数字进行四舍五入:
let rounded = Math.round(3.14); // 返回最接近的整数
- 计算平方根:
let sqrt = Math.sqrt(16); // 返回平方根
步骤四:使用Date对象的方法和属性
- 创建一个日期对象:
let date = new Date();
- 获取年份:
let year = date.getFullYear();
- 获取月份:
let month = date.getMonth();
- 获取日期:
let day = date.getDate();
步骤五:使用Object对象的方法和属性
- 创建一个空对象:
let obj = {};
- 添加属性和值:
obj.name = "John"; // 添加属性name并赋值为John
obj.age = 20; // 添加属性age并赋值为20
- 访问属性的值:
let name = obj.name;
let age = obj.age;
步骤六:使用JSON对象的方法
- 将JavaScript对象转换为JSON字符串:
let obj = {name: "John", age: 20};
let json = JSON.stringify(obj); // 转换为JSON字符串
- 将JSON字符串转换为